稳定丝状发光的电极条形InP-In1-xGaxAs1-yPyDH激光器
InP-In1-xGaxAs1-yPy ELECTRODE-STRIPE DH LASER WITH STABLE FILAMENT LIGHTING
【摘要】 本文叙述了电极条形InP-In1-xGaxAs1-yPyDH激光器的特性。由于有源区的不均匀而导致灯丝状发光行为,在一定注入电流水平以下可得到稳定的横模工作。电流扩展效应可能是电极条形器件的T0低于其他条形结构器件的原因之一,15μm条宽的器件在1.3倍阈值前是单纵模工作。随着注入电流的增加,波长向长波方向移动的变化率是0.8/mA。
【Abstract】 The characteristics of InP-In1-xGaxAs1-yPy electrodestripe DH laser is described. Non-uniform active reigion can lead to filament lighting, and stable transverse mode can be obtained at certain injection current level. The effect of current spreading may be one of the reasons why T0 of electrode-stripe device is lower than that of other structural devices. The device with stripe width 15μm keeps on operating with single longitudinal mode until more than 1.3 times of threshold current is given. The wavelength moves at rate of 0.8/mA to the direction of longer wavelengths as injection current increases.
